Council members question sharp increase in mobile food truck permit fee; request legal and process review
Summary
Committee members raised concerns after the Board of Health increased the mobile food truck permit fee to $300—council members requested the fee-analysis spreadsheet and asked staff and law department to clarify which fees fall under council authority vs. the health board's state-approved process.
Members of the Committee of the Whole raised concerns about a recent Board of Health change that increased the fee for a mobile food truck permit to $300. Committee members said, based on their preliminary research, that $300 would be among the highest mobile-food permit fees in the state and is substantially higher than recent charges in neighboring jurisdictions.
Committee members explained they view the increase as significant for food-service operators, whose profit margins are typically narrow.
